    2016 Spark: What went wrong? Predicted and actual ranges used to agree.

    I won't say the LFP Sparks don't lose energy, my 2014 spark capacity dropped to 15.5 kWh usable before I sold it in 2018, while it was 18 kWh+ when I first got it in 2015. There is capacity loss in LFP packs too.

    Setting the charging time

    The Spark EV's charge timer was better than my 2012 Volt's. GM's charge preference timers is head and shoulders above current Tesla (Model 3) which has nothing other than scheduled start time (which is shocking to me TBH). I was able to program all TOU 4 price periods on my Spark EV no problem.
